Output ef6665d8aab8a1005be836aad4a5a7e4ba85ce1aba2871518a9781495c1ce6da:1

value
2900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442f428257c06fb000b9959ded9d715660428b11 OP_EQUALVERIFY OP_CHECKSIG
address
17DXZiMeb9hFLF31qdSarcSC5kvAitWBL7
transaction
ef6665d8aab8a1005be836aad4a5a7e4ba85ce1aba2871518a9781495c1ce6da
spent
true